During today's conversation, we interview vocal and performance coach, Per Bristow and hear his philosophy on life and performance. Tune in to hear why the pressure is greater, the more talented you are, why understanding your psychology is pertinent to beating stage fright, and how the most dangerous thing about stress is our negative perception of it. Per doesn't advocate avoiding fear, but rather urges listeners to embrace it, in order to empower themselves to do something about it. He believes that the principles he teaches in voice training should be applied to all areas of life, and encourages listeners to embrace spontaneity and aliveness over having a plan and being so attached to an outcome. His advice to people heading to the stage is to embrace and expect nervousness and allow it to show us that we are taking part in a special moment. Next, we get into the technicalities of voice training and Per shares the story of how he learned that anyone can improve their vocal abilities dramatically, the same way that you can build muscle. You'll hear all about Per's philosophy on developing the voice, embracing your accent, and why folks who stutter do so far less when they sing. We touch on sleep, hydration, caffeine, and more. Per Bristow is a singing teacher, voice coach and performance coach who teaches throughout the world from his home base in the Los Angeles area. He is the creator of The Bristow Voice Method – a unique method for freeing the voice which is based on muscle isolation, strength development, and peak performance techniques. For more than 15 years this unique method has empowered tens of thousands of singers and speakers from over 132 nations to heal, build and free their voices.The Bristow Voice Method was born out of Per Bristow’s vast experience as a performing musician, singer, actor and athlete, his many years of experience as a teacher and coach, and his depth of knowledge in areas of human anatomy, modern training methods, advanced learning strategies, peak performance psychology, advanced mental training techniques, nutrition and more.The method is designed to go far beyond improving the physical voice. BVM serves to bring the individual to significantly greater levels of well-being, self-confidence, creativity and health, in addition to dramatically and rapidly improve communication, presentation and performance skills.Per grew up in Sweden and was recognized as a prodigy violin player. At the age of 12 he was the youngest ever invited into the city’s symphony orchestra. However, in his early teens he preferred to pursue sports – but with little success. It was much through the process of healing from a back injury that he discovered how to transfer the ability to learn rapidly from one field to another.Now with the Sing With Freedom program and The Singing Zone the strategies of The Bristow Voice Method is available in home study format to people all over the world.https://www.perbristow.com/https://www.thesingingzone.com/Chloe Goodchild is an international singer, innovatory educator, author and founder of The Naked Voice (1990) and its UK Charitable Foundation (2004), dedicated to the realization of compassionate communication in all realms of human life.
